2. Important Elements of the Genre
The “material” of a cop film is its storytelling style. Some films focus on “buddy cop” dynamics. These stories rely on the chemistry between two partners. Other films focus on “neo-noir” themes. These stories use dark lighting and moody music to show the gritty side of city life. You should decide if you want a fun, lighthearted movie or a serious, dark thriller.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Are all cop films about solving murders?
A: No. Many cop films focus on drug busts, bank robberies, or political corruption.
Q: What is a “buddy cop” movie?
A: This is a film where two very different police officers must work together to solve a case.

Q: What is a “police procedural”?
A: This is a type of story that shows the step-by-step process of how police officers solve a crime.
